The average cost for a reading tutor in Oregon City, OR as of May 2026 is $25.50 per hour. Rates can vary based on the tutor’s experience, education level, and the type of support needed. Tutors with specialized training in literacy, early education, or learning differences may charge higher rates, while group sessions or recurring schedules may offer more consistent pricing.
Reading tutors in Oregon City, OR help students develop key literacy skills such as phonics, vocabulary, reading fluency, and comprehension. Depending on the child’s needs, tutors may focus on early reading fundamentals, improving confidence, or helping with school assignments and test preparation. Sessions are often tailored to the student’s grade level and learning style.
To find a good reading tutor in Oregon City, OR, many parents compare profiles based on experience, teaching approach, and reviews from other families. It’s helpful to ask about the tutor’s methods, familiarity with your child’s curriculum, and experience working with similar age groups. Scheduling an initial session can also help determine if the tutor is a good fit.
Parents in Oregon City, OR often consider hiring a reading tutor when a child is struggling with reading skills, falling behind in school, or lacking confidence. Early support can help build strong foundational skills, while older students may benefit from targeted help with comprehension or academic performance. Tutors can also support children who simply want to advance their reading abilities.
Many reading tutors in Oregon City, OR have experience supporting students with learning differences such as dyslexia or attention challenges. Some tutors specialize in structured literacy approaches or individualized learning plans. It’s important to ask about a tutor’s experience and training to ensure they can effectively support your child’s specific needs.
Before hiring a reading tutor in Oregon City, OR, consider asking about their teaching experience, approach to instruction, and familiarity with your child’s grade level. You may also want to discuss goals, expected progress, and how sessions will be structured. Understanding how the tutor tracks improvement and communicates updates can help ensure a successful experience.
